## Service accounts: Sheetpress exporter

The Sheetpress export worker runs under the svc-sheetpress account, which got its own identity after the big memory blowup — streaming exports now chunk rows instead of buffering whole workbooks. Reviewers: the account has read-only access to the Fernlake warehouse and nothing else. It authenticates to the warehouse proxy with the key below.

service key, fawip-bajef: kto11_Qt5wZK9vdNC

Leadership Review Briefing — Large-Deal Discount Policy

For the incoming director: Velmora Systems currently permits regional leads to approve discounts up to 12% on deals above the Tier-3 threshold. Analysis of the past four quarters shows discounting concentrated in the Harwick territory, often without documented justification. We propose tightening approval gates and requiring margin impact notes on all Tier-3 submissions. The attached confidential note outlines how this connects to next year's pricing strategy.

internal memo for kawip-hadug: Headcount on the Wenwyn team goes from 7 to 140 by the end of January. Gross margin on Wenwyn came in at 20 percent against a plan of 15 percent.

## Reminder job: Larkmoor Clinic

The remind-patients job runs at 06:30 daily via the Tollbell scheduler. It pulls tomorrow's appointments from Chartbase, filters out opted-out patients, and hands messages to the Pigeonpost sender. If the job fails mid-batch, rerun is safe — Pigeonpost deduplicates by appointment reference for 24 hours. Do not run it more than twice per day; the dedupe window won't save you a third time. The job authenticates to Pigeonpost with the key below.

gateway credential: kto23_LX9A4ys6i4nzHtpOLNLodKK

Subject: Key rotation — Queuewright cutover

Team,

As flagged at last sync: we're retiring the homegrown job queue (Stacklate) this sprint in favor of Queuewright. All Stacklate credentials expire Thursday EOD. No action needed for services already on the new dispatch client; everything else must re-auth against Queuewright's internal endpoint before cutover. Dry-run jobs are replaying cleanly in staging, so no schedule slip expected. Raise blockers in the sync thread, not DMs. The rotated key for the internal dispatch service follows.

gateway credential: kto3_qfe